What Does Dreaming About Crab Mean?
Dreaming of a crab symbolizes emotional protection, regression, and the hard outer shell of the psyche.
📌 Short Meaning
Represents the need for emotional protection, fragility hidden behind a tough exterior, and a tendency toward withdrawal.

→Dream About Crab: Detailed Interpretation
Dreaming of a crab represents the need for emotional protection, a tendency to withdraw, and a period when the dreamer raises defensive walls against the surroundings. The crab is one of the rare figures that simultaneously carries both fragility and the hard outer shell developed to conceal that vulnerability. Therefore, crab dreams shed light on the tension between the dreamer's inner world and the attitude they project to the external world.
Interpretation Based on Crab Behavior
When a crab tightly grips something with its claws, it points to a relationship, idea, or past issue that the dreamer cannot let go of. The crab's sideways walk suggests an indirect approach to goals rather than a direct path forward. The crab retreating into its shell symbolizes a desire for silence in response to tension in one's immediate circle.
Interpretation Based on the Crab's Location
Seeing a crab swimming in the sea represents a discovery made in emotional depths and emotions maturing in the unconscious. A crab on the beach indicates the transitional zone between conscious awareness and suppressed emotions, showing that the person is preparing to bring some feelings to the surface. A crab hidden in rocky areas speaks of a situation requiring caution in work or family life.
Interpretation Based on Interaction with the Crab
Catching a crab represents a gain obtained through effort but valuable nonetheless, indicating that patient work will bear fruit. Being pinched by a crab shows that words or actions from someone close have hurt you, and this pain will linger for a while. Releasing a crab symbolizes a decision to let go of a burden or resentment carried for a long time.
🕌 Islamic Dream Interpretation
In the Islamic dream interpretation tradition, a crab most often represents a person who acts deceitfully, does not openly reveal their intentions, and attempts to achieve their goals through indirect means. Classical interpreters evaluated the crab's sideways movement and hard shell as indicators of concealed aspects of character.
According to Ibn Sirin
In the interpretations attributed to Ibn Sirin, a crab refers to a scheming, evasive person who hides their intentions. Catching a crab in a dream points to discovering such a person's games and dealing with them. Eating crab meat, though small in quantity, is interpreted as lawful provision obtained honestly. Being harmed by a crab's claws foretells trouble coming through gossip.
According to Al-Nabulsi
According to Al-Nabulsi's tradition, seeing a crab points to maritime trade, a journey to distant lands, or provision obtained from the sea. A crab calmly wandering on the shore is interpreted as matters progressing slowly but surely. Seeing many crabs represents competitive people in one's circle and a work environment requiring caution.
According to Ja'far al-Sadiq
In interpretations attributed to Ja'far al-Sadiq, a crab carries meanings of patience, secrecy, and wealth obtained with difficulty. Breaking a crab's shell refers to a hidden truth being revealed; cooking and eating a crab points to a blessed outcome after completing a laborious task.
🧠 Psychological Interpretation
Psychologically, crab dreams are a symbolic reflection of emotional defense mechanisms and a tendency toward withdrawal. This creature, carrying a soft body beneath a hard shell, represents the contradiction between the strong demeanor the person shows to the world and the fragility felt within.
Jung's Archetypal Approach
In Jung's approach, the crab establishes a strong connection with the protective aspect of the persona archetype. The shell symbolizes the face the person presents to the external world and their social armor, while the soft body inside the shell represents the true self. The crab diving into water indicates that suppressed emotions in the unconscious are beginning to surface. These dreams can herald the approach of a confrontation with the shadow.
Freud's Unconscious Interpretation
According to Freudian thought, the crab can be seen as a symbol of the need for protection carried from childhood and the search for security tied to the mother. The claws are controlled expressions of repressed anger or passion. The crab attacking reflects how accumulated tension in the unconscious surfaces indirectly when it cannot find an appropriate outlet.
Reflection in Daily Life
In daily life, a person who dreams of a crab often adopts a defensive stance in close relationships and hesitates at emotional closeness. This symbol can point to behavioral patterns such as excessive sensitivity to criticism, inability to release past hurts, or avoidance of risk-taking in work life. Distinguishing when the shell is protective and when it is limiting becomes an important step toward personal development.
